Crossbeam is a software platform that helps businesses of all sizes grow their revenue by leveraging their partner ecosystems. It allows you to securely share data with your partners and identify common customers and prospects. This helps your sales team uncover new leads, speed up sales cycles, and expand existing accounts. Crossbeam integrates with popular CRM systems and data sources, making it easy to get started and see results.
PartnerStack is a leading software platform designed to help businesses grow through partnerships. It provides tools to find, recruit, and manage affiliates, influencers, and other business partners. With PartnerStack, you can automate partner payments, track performance, and gain insights to optimize your partner program. PartnerStack is best known for its focus on B2B software companies and boasts a large network of potential partners.
Summary
Main difference
Crossbeam is better for you if you prioritize identifying overlapping customers and prospects for co-selling opportunities with existing partners. PartnerStack is better for you if you need a comprehensive platform to recruit, manage, and track various partner types, including affiliates and influencers, to build and scale your partner program.
Relative strengths of Crossbeam (compared to PartnerStack)
Stronger focus on account mapping and co-selling with existing partners via data sharing.
Seamless integrations with popular CRM systems like Salesforce.
Offers a free plan suitable for basic account mapping and partner discovery.
Relative weaknesses of Crossbeam (compared to PartnerStack)
Limited partner recruitment capabilities compared to PartnerStack.
Fewer integrations with CRMs beyond Salesforce (e.g., Zoho).
Limited payment options compared to PartnerStack (PayPal and Stripe).

Crossbeam and PartnerStack Pricing
Crossbeam offers a free plan and paid plans called Connector and Supernode. Crossbeam for Sales is an add-on available for Connector and Supernode plans.
Plans
FreeExplorer
Add up to 3 seats. Segment and compare ecosystem data with 3 Standard Populations. Identify overlapping accounts with Standard Account Mapping up to 50 records. Collaborate on shared account lists by invitation. Preview overlap data in Salesforce and HubSpot via Copilot. Capture Ecosystem Intelligence with the Crossbeam Slack app.
$150 per user/monthConnector
No seat minimums, add users as you grow. Segment and compare ecosystem data with 3 Standard Populations and 3 Custom Populations. Identify and action overlapping accounts with Advanced Account Mapping. Collaborate with partners using Shared Lists. Make co-selling a team sport with full Crossbeam for Sales access with every seat. Action partner data with Outbound Integrations available on the Connector Plan*. Action data with Ecosystem Notifications. *Does not include Salesforce or HubSpot Custom Object, Snowflake, Impartner, Clari, Adobe Marketo, LeanData, and Clay
CustomSupernode
Segment and compare ecosystem data with unlimited Populations. Send partner data everywhere with unlimited integrations. Attribute partner-sourced and influenced revenue. Unlock enterprise-grade custom roles and permissions. Make data governance a breeze with Audit Logs. Get world-class onboarding and support with a dedicated Customer Success Manager.
PartnerStack's pricing is custom and based on individual business needs. Interested users must fill out a form to get a personalized plan and pricing. All plans include access to B2B-focused partners, automated partner payments, partner journey automation, and partner analytics.

How important is a pre-built partner network for my business?
The importance of a pre-built partner network depends on your existing resources and strategic goals. If you lack the time or resources to build a partner network from scratch, PartnerStack's large, pre-built network offers a significant advantage. However, if you already have a robust network or prefer a more curated approach to partnerships, Crossbeam's focus on data sharing and collaboration within your existing network might be more valuable.
Which platform better facilitates co-selling with existing partners?
Crossbeam more directly facilitates co-selling with existing partners. Its core functionality centers around identifying overlapping customers and prospects with partners, enabling joint selling opportunities. While PartnerStack offers valuable partner management features, its focus is broader, encompassing affiliate marketing, influencer programs, and reseller management, making it less specialized for co-selling activities compared to Crossbeam.
What are the advantages of Crossbeam?
Crossbeam's advantages lie in its focus on account mapping and deal acceleration through partner ecosystems. It excels at identifying overlapping customers and prospects, facilitating co-selling opportunities, and providing valuable insights for sales teams. Its seamless Salesforce integration is a significant plus for users of that CRM. Additionally, Crossbeam offers a free plan, making it accessible for smaller businesses or those wanting to test its capabilities before committing to a paid subscription.
What are the disadvantages of Crossbeam?
Crossbeam's disadvantages include potential data discrepancies due to inconsistencies in CRM data, limited CRM integrations (specifically noted with Zoho), inability to report on data from the Crossbeam widget within the CRM, and potential record limits that might restrict larger companies.
